## Alzheimer's Care in Easton, MD: A Hospital Scorecard Near 21640
Finding quality Alzheimer's care is a pressing concern for families. This review analyzes hospital resources near Easton, Maryland (ZIP code 21640), focusing on factors critical for Alzheimer's patients and their caregivers. We'll examine hospital quality indicators, including CMS star ratings, emergency room wait times, specialized centers, and telehealth capabilities.
**The Landscape: Hospitals in Proximity**
The immediate area surrounding Easton, MD, offers a limited number of hospitals. The primary healthcare providers within a reasonable radius are the University of Maryland Shore Regional Health system, which operates several facilities, including the flagship hospital in Easton. Other options, though further afield, include hospitals in Annapolis and Baltimore, requiring longer travel times.
**University of Maryland Shore Medical Center at Easton: The Cornerstone**
The University of Maryland Shore Medical Center at Easton (UM Shore Medical Center at Easton) serves as the primary hospital for residents of 21640. It's crucial to assess its capabilities in Alzheimer's care.
**CMS Star Rating:** UM Shore Medical Center at Easton's CMS star rating is a key indicator of overall hospital quality. CMS assigns star ratings based on various metrics, including patient experience, readmission rates, and mortality rates. A higher star rating generally indicates better performance. (Note: Specific star ratings fluctuate and should be verified on the CMS Hospital Compare website for the most up-to-date information.)
**Emergency Room Performance:** ER wait times are a significant concern, particularly for patients with cognitive impairments who may experience heightened anxiety in emergency situations. Data on ER wait times, including the time from arrival to a doctor's assessment and the overall length of stay, is available on the CMS Hospital Compare website. (Check the most current data.)
**Specialty Centers and Geriatric Expertise:** Does UM Shore Medical Center at Easton have a dedicated memory care unit or a geriatric center? These specialized units often provide comprehensive care tailored to the needs of Alzheimer's patients. Look for multidisciplinary teams including neurologists, geriatricians, psychiatrists, and social workers. Inquire about their experience with diagnosing and managing Alzheimer's disease and related dementias.
**Telehealth Capabilities:** Telehealth has become increasingly important, especially for patients with mobility limitations or those living in rural areas. Does UM Shore Medical Center at Easton offer telehealth consultations with neurologists or geriatric specialists? Telehealth can provide access to specialized care and support for patients and their families.
**Other Shore Regional Health Facilities:** The University of Maryland Shore Regional Health system operates other facilities in the area, such as outpatient clinics and rehabilitation centers. These facilities may offer additional services relevant to Alzheimer's care, such as physical therapy, occupational therapy, and speech therapy.

**Factors to Consider in Your Decision**
Choosing the right hospital for Alzheimer's care involves several factors beyond CMS star ratings and wait times.
**Physician Expertise:** The experience and expertise of the physicians are paramount. Look for neurologists, geriatricians, and other specialists with specific training and experience in Alzheimer's disease.
**Caregiver Support:** Alzheimer's care is incredibly demanding for caregivers. Assess the hospital's support services for caregivers, including support groups, educational programs, and respite care options.
**Patient Experience:** Patient experience is a critical factor. Review patient satisfaction surveys and read online reviews to get insights into the hospital's culture of care and its responsiveness to patient needs.
**Access to Clinical Trials:** If appropriate, consider hospitals that offer access to clinical trials for Alzheimer's disease. Clinical trials can provide access to experimental treatments and contribute to advancements in care.
**Financial Considerations:** Understand the costs associated with care, including hospital charges, physician fees, and medication costs. Verify insurance coverage and explore financial assistance options if needed.
**The Importance of Proactive Planning**
Planning for Alzheimer's care is essential. Early diagnosis and intervention can improve outcomes.
**Diagnosis and Assessment:** Seek prompt medical attention if you or a loved one experiences memory loss or other cognitive changes. A thorough evaluation by a neurologist or geriatrician is crucial for accurate diagnosis.
**Care Planning:** Develop a comprehensive care plan that addresses the patient's medical, social, and emotional needs. This plan should involve the patient, family members, and healthcare professionals.
**Legal and Financial Planning:** Address legal and financial matters early on. Establish a durable power of attorney, a healthcare proxy, and a living will. Consider long-term care insurance and explore financial planning options.
**Community Resources:** Utilize community resources, such as the Alzheimer's Association, local support groups, and adult day care centers. These resources can provide valuable support and information.
